Transaction 53f9310419e3c2b040d90a332ebd6162f26b767de42ffdd8a1f9b434ce3b9ddf
1 Input
1 Output
-
53f9310419e3c2b040d90a332ebd6162f26b767de42ffdd8a1f9b434ce3b9ddf:0
- value
- 1191638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b4c90423c6794c21784864a744cc01b11faf3fb OP_EQUAL
- address
- 3EPZZw8nWjsH124ujPSKZWBG3w3g7RZsA3